// PAYROLL_EXPORT_FORMAT_VERSION
//
// Bumped for the Tallowmark payroll export change: the flat-file
// layout now uses fixed-width deduction fields instead of
// delimited ones. Downstream consumers at the Brindle clearing
// service reject mixed formats, so this constant gates which
// serializer runs. Do not bump without coordinating a cutover
// window. Reviewer: confirm the serializer tests reference the
// same version. The constant was last validated against the
// build identified by the token below.

trace token, fafog-kageg: htk4_98e6

The FeeForge shipping-fee rules engine uses two service accounts: `feeforge-eval` for runtime rule evaluation and `feeforge-deploy` for publishing rule bundles. Release cuts only require the deploy account; evaluation credentials are managed by the platform team and rotate automatically. When promoting a bundle from staging to production, the release pipeline calls the publish endpoint under `feeforge-deploy`. If you need to trigger a manual publish outside the pipeline, authenticate against the internal admin API using the key below.

app token of badug-tahaf = qvz11-nP5FBNr8qnh

**Ticket: Config drift on Quellpoint dedup nodes**

The alert deduplicator in the Marwick cluster is grouping differently than staging. Someone hand-edited the window settings during last month's incident and never reverted. Symptoms: duplicate pages for the same host. Until the redeploy lands, the expected production values are shown below.

settings of bawif-fawif:
ralix:
  log_level: warn
  metrics_host: metrics.ralix.tolvaqsys.internal
  pool_size: 32

11:03 — Breaker on the Corvid upstream quota API tripped after 5 consecutive 502s. Fail-closed as designed; no unauthenticated fallback occurred. 11:09 — Half-open probe succeeded, traffic restored. 11:15 — Confirmed no auth tokens logged during the open state. No data exposure. Follow-up: tighten probe interval. The deploy under review is identified by the trace token below.

session token of tajef-bageg = htk21_5d90d574934f3ccae6437